Outline of Final Research Achievements

Attention deficit/hyperactivity disorder (ADHD) is neurobehavioral disorder characterized by inattention, hyperactivity /impulsivity and impaired reward system function, such as delay aversion, and low reward sensitivity. We evaluated brain activation with fMRI and brain volume with VBM. We found that decreased activations of the nucleus accumbens and thalamus of the ADHD patients during only the low monetary reward condition before the treatment were improved to same level as those of the healthy adolescents after the treatment. The observed improvement in brain activity was associated with improved ADHD symptom scores. In addition, a combinational analysis of brain and genetic polymorphisms in children with ADHD revealed a significant association between the left putamen GMV reduction and COMT polymorphism. These results suggest that a combinational analysis of brain and genetic polymorphisms is useful in detecting neural basis in children with ADHD.
